Understanding PC Account Backup Automatic Technology

Automatic PC account backup technology operates at the system level to capture comprehensive snapshots of user accounts, including profiles, settings, application configurations, and associated data. This approach differs significantly from traditional file-based backup solutions that may miss critical system components required for complete account restoration.

Modern pc account backup automatic solutions utilize sector-level imaging technology that captures entire system states rather than individual files. This comprehensive approach ensures that when restoration becomes necessary, the entire computing environment returns to its previous functional state, including user permissions, installed applications, and personalized settings.

The automation component eliminates human error and ensures consistent protection policies across your organization. Scheduled snapshots occur at predetermined intervals without disrupting user productivity, while intelligent algorithms determine optimal backup timing based on system activity patterns.

Core Components of Effective Account Backup

Effective automatic account backup systems incorporate several essential elements that work together to provide comprehensive protection. User profile management captures personalized desktop settings, application preferences, and custom configurations that make each workstation unique to its primary user.

Registry protection ensures that system-level account information remains intact during restoration processes. Windows registry entries contain crucial authentication data, permission structures, and application associations that traditional backup methods frequently overlook.

Application data synchronization maintains consistency between user accounts and their associated software installations. This includes cached credentials, productivity software settings, and specialized application configurations that users rely on for daily operations.

Comparison of Backup Methodologies

Backup Method Recovery Speed Automation Level System Coverage Management Complexity
Traditional File Backup Hours to Days Manual Scheduling Files Only High
System Imaging Moderate Scheduled Complete System Moderate
Snapshot Technology Seconds to Minutes Fully Automated Sector-Level Complete Low
Cloud Synchronization Variable Continuous Selected Data Moderate

This comparison highlights the advantages of modern snapshot-based pc account backup automatic systems over traditional approaches. Recovery speed represents a critical factor in business continuity planning, while automation levels determine the consistency and reliability of protection policies.

Scalability and Performance Optimization

Modern backup systems scale efficiently from single workstations to thousands of endpoints without degrading performance or requiring proportional increases in administrative overhead. Intelligent resource management ensures that backup operations occur during periods of low system activity.

Bandwidth optimization features minimize network impact during backup operations, particularly important for organizations with limited internet connectivity or branch offices connected via slower connections.

Storage efficiency improvements include data deduplication and compression technologies that reduce backup storage requirements while maintaining complete restoration capabilities. These optimizations prove especially valuable for organizations managing large numbers of similar workstation configurations.
